Which fog is formed when warm, moist air is blown over a cool surface?

Explanation:
The formation of advection fog occurs when warm, moist air is moved over a cooler surface, leading to the cooling of the air to its dew point and thus forming fog. This process typically happens when warm air from the ocean travels over cooler land or water bodies, causing the moisture in the air to condense into tiny water droplets that create fog. In contrast, upslope fog forms when moist air is lifted over a terrain, leading to cooling as it ascends. Steam fog arises when cold air moves over warm water, causing moisture to evaporate and then condense. Radiation fog typically forms during the night when the ground cools rapidly, chilling the air close to the surface. Thus, the characteristics of advection fog make it unique in its formation process from warm air interacting with a cooler surface.

Understanding the Exam Format

The ACS Airman Certification Test comprises multiple-choice questions designed to assess your understanding of key aviation concepts. The exam format varies slightly depending on the specific certification you are pursuing, with 40 to 60 questions generally included in the test.

Key Features of the Exam:

  • Number of Questions: Typically ranges from 40 to 60 questions.
  • Time Limit: You will have a limited time frame to complete the test, usually between 2 to 3 hours depending on the type of certification.
  • Question Types: All questions are multiple-choice with three possible answers to choose from.
  • Pass Mark: A minimum score of 70% is often required to pass.

Understanding the format helps you pace yourself and manage your time effectively during the exam.

What to Expect on the ACS Airman Certification Test

The content of the ACS Airman Certification Test is based on the FAA’s established standards specific to your certification level. These standards ensure that tests are consistent and relevant to current aviation practices.

Subjects Covered:

  1. Airspace Regulations: Familiarize yourself with the different types of airspaces and the corresponding regulations.
  2. Flight Operations: Learn about standard operating procedures and abbreviations used in aviation.
  3. Navigation: Develop competency in map reading, understanding VORs, and other navigational aids.
  4. Meteorology: Basic and advanced understanding of weather patterns, effects of weather on flight, and meteorological terminologies.
  5. Aircraft Systems and Performance: Expected knowledge of aircraft instruments, hydraulics, engines, and performance metrics.
  6. Human Factors: Focus on situational awareness, stress management, and cockpit resource management.
  7. Communications: Mastery of aviation phraseology and effective communications especially in complex environments.
